sonyps4.ru

Безопасное отключение usb устройств. Проблема с универсальным томом

Как правильно пользоваться USB-накопителями? Этот вопрос беспокоит практически всех владельцев таких устройств.

Некоторые пользователи полагают, что можно ограничиться простым извлечением USB-накопителей и отказаться от лишних манипуляций с мышью, т.е. не прибегать к безопасному извлечению флешек . Так ли это на самом деле?

Если придерживаться данного мнения, рано или поздно можно столкнуться с двумя неприятными вещами:

  • Во-первых, существует возможность утраты ценной информации, которая содержится на флешке.
  • Во-вторых, можно испортить сам накопитель и о дальнейшей работе с ним можно не думать.

Данные могут потеряться не только при извлечении флешки во время копирования или перемещения файлов, но и просто так. Это порой у многих вызывает полную неожиданность. Вроде бы никаких манипуляций не производил, а файлы и папки куда-то подевались.

Такая ситуация особенно встречается при использовании USB-накопителей с файловой системой NTFS. Под диски с данной системой ОС создает специальную область для хранения копируемых данных, т.е. информация записывается на флешку не сразу. Чтобы избежать данной ситуации, необходимо использовать «Безопасное извлечение устройства».

Также при простом (точнее, опасном) извлечении флешек может возникнуть неожиданный импульс повышенного напряжения или просто короткое замыкание. В этом случае велика вероятность повреждения электронных компонентов накопителя, они просто выгорают.

После вышеизложенного приходим к выводу о необходимости безопасного извлечения флешки. Ведь не зря сама операционная система предлагает провести данную манипуляцию, которая занимает считанные секунды.

Использование «Безопасного извлечения устройства» поможет Вам сохранить данные и сам накопитель в целости и сохранности.

Как провести безопасное извлечение флешек?

О том, как сделать правильное отключение любого внешнего устройства для Windows XP, в частности, флешки, подробно, с разбором «непонятных, странных» ситуаций описано .

Для Windows 10 можно использовать для того, чтобы безопасно извлекать внешнее устройство.

Ниже рассмотрим в общем виде безопасное извлечение флешки для Windows 7, хотя принципиальной разницы с Windows XP и с десяткой в этом вопросе нет никакой.

Сначала закрываем программу, в паре с которой работала флешка. Затем кликаем по маленькому треугольнику в правой части , при наведении на который указателя мыши можно увидеть надпись «Отображать скрытые значки» (на скриншоте этот треугольник обозначен цифрой 1):

Хотя вполне может быть, что значок «Безопасное извлечение устройств и дисков» (цифра 2) находится прямо на Панели задач. Кстати, если к компьютеру не подключено ни одно устройство через порт USB, то этого значка (№ 2 на скриншоте) Вы не увидите по причине того, что компьютер понимает, что, собственно, извлекать Вам нечего – «на нет и суда нет».

Итак, чтобы правильно отключить флешку, достаточно после закрытия той программы, с которой работала флешка, кликнуть по значку «Безопасное извлечение устройств и дисков», после чего появится окно примерно такое:

Кликнув по «Извлечь Mass Storage Device», увидим сообщение, что «Оборудование может быть извлечено»:

После этого можно вынуть флешку из порта USB.

Все сказанное выше о безопасном извлечении флешки имеет отношение не только к флешке, но и к любому другому устройству, которое подключается к компьютеру через порт USB.

Независимо от операционной системы, при извлечении флешки всегда рекомендуется перед тем как физически вытянуть устройство из компьютера, отключить его от системы программно.Действительно ли это так важно и нужно?

В этой статье мы попытаемся разобраться зачем нужно безопасное извлечение флешки и действительно ли оно так необходимо. Хотя статья ориентированна более на Linux, но эта задача общая для всех операционных систем, поэтому она будет полезна также пользователям MacOS и Windows.

Если я вас попрошу извлечь флешку из компьютера во время того как на нее пишутся данные, то, скорее всего, вы откажетесь это делать. Вы знаете, что сейчас данные записываются на диск и если его отключить, то со стопроцентной вероятностью данные на флешке будут повреждены, и точно не будут записаны.

Но тем не менее, даже если ваша флешка не находится в активном состоянии, ее непредвиденное извлечение может привести к повреждению данных. Это происходит из-за кэширования, которое используется во всех операционных системах. При копировании информация не записывается сразу на диск USB вместо этого для ускорения работы устройства ее часть хранится в оперативной памяти и записывается тогда, когда система будет более свободна или когда вы захотите извлечь флешку.

Система не всегда переносит данные сразу на диск, поэтому если вы неожиданно для системы вытянете флешку из разъема, возможно, не все данные будут правильно записаны. Вероятность такого исхода ниже, чем при активной работе флешки, но она есть.

Почему Linux, MacOS и Windows ведут себя по-разному?

Операционные системы ведут себя почти одинаково при работе с любым диском. Это относится не только к флешкам, но и встроенным в корпус жестким дискам. Данные, которые нужно записать сначала попадают в память и находятся там кое-какое время. Также прочитанные данные кэшируются в оперативной памяти, на случай если они еще раз будут нужны.

Благодаря этому система работает быстрее. Ведь в один момент времени с жестким диском или флешкой может выполняться только одна операция записи или чтения, и возможно, в данный момент у системы есть более важные задачи, чем записать ваш файл.

Безопасное извлечение флешки Linux и MacOS даже больше нужно, чем в Windows при настройках по умолчанию. Почему так? Операционная система Windows не использует кэширование для дисков, которые считает съемными. Такое поведение системы по умолчанию, но его можно изменить в сторону лучшей производительности. Для этого откройте Диспетчер устройств> Дисковые устройства> Название диска> Свойства> Политики:

С другой стороны, Linux и Mac используют кэширование для всех дисков по умолчанию, в том числе и съемных. Точно так же себя будет вести Windows если вы выберите вариант Лучшая производительность . Linux дает вам полный контроль над управлением дисками, в том числе вы можете указать нужно ли кэшировать данные. Для этого достаточно создать запись для монтирования флешки в /etc/fstab и добавить опцию монтирования sync . Например:

/dev/sdb1 /run/media/flash users,noatime,sync 0 0

Если вы используете опцию монтирования sync, то все данные, которые будут отправляться на диск будут сразу же записаны. Но обратите внимание, что опция sync не отменяет безопасное извлечение usb устройства. Правильное размонтирование гарантирует, что больше никакое приложение не работает с флешкой и там нет не сохраненных данных.

Если устройство не размонтировано, а файл открыт в какой-либо программе, то неожиданное извлечение может привести к повреждению на уровне файловой системы. Возможно, там остались незавершенные операции перед тем как файл будет закрыт.

Кроме того, опция sync плохо сказывается на сроке службы флешки. Ядро выполняет запись в пакетном режиме, в каждый сектор как только это потребуется. Для дешевых флешек, которые не перераспределяют сервера современная журналируемая файловая система может стать последней и очень быстро убить устройство.

Для файловых систем FAT можно использовать опцию монтирования flush. Она записывает данные как только диск становится неактивным. Это немного улучшает ситуацию.

Всегда используйте безопасное извлечение

Если вы извлечете флешку и перед этим ее не размонтируете, с самой флешкой вряд-ли что случится, она точно не сгорит. Но если в это время что-то записывало на нее данные, то они будут утеряны. Поэтому лучше взять за правило всегда размонтировать флешку linux перед тем, как ее вынуть из компьютера, причем это справедливо не только для Linux, но и Windows.

Тем более, что выполняется все это в пару кликов мышкой. В Ubuntu это можно сделать с помощью проводника. В KDE есть специальный виджет на панели задач, который позволяет безопасно извлечь флешку:

Если вы хотите выполнить это действие через терминал, то все делается тоже ненамного сложнее:

sudo umount /dev/sdb1

Здесь sdb1 - имя устройства флешки в вашей системе. После этого флешка будет подготовлена к извлечению. В Windows это нужно делать обязательно, потому что в отличие от Linux, эта система может сама, без вашего ведома начать выполнять какие-либо действия с флешкой, например создать папку System Volume Information с метафайлами.

Возможность безопасного извлечения устройства знакома пользователям ещё с предыдущих версий операционной системы Windows. Поскольку текущая функция множество раз помогала пользователям сохранить работоспособность внешних устройств и дисков, то сразу же было понятно что в новой операционной системе Windows 10 такая возможность сохранится.

Данная статья расскажет как правильно использовать безопасное извлечение устройства в Windows 10, и собственно как безопасно извлечь флешку из компьютера Windows 10. Рекомендуем новичкам обратить внимание на пункт извлечение флешки без безопасного извлечения. А также рассмотрим что необходимо делать когда пропал значок безопасное извлечение устройства Windows 10.

Безопасное извлечение устройства в Windows 10 необходимо обязательно использовать при подключении внешних устройств и дисков. А также рекомендуется использовать при подключении обычной флешки.

Чтобы безопасно извлечь флешку из компьютера под управлением операционной системы Windows 10 необходимо на панели задач нажать правой кнопкой мыши на значок Безопасное извлечение устройств и дисков , и в контекстном меню выбрать пункт Извлечь «Запоминающее устройство для USB» .

Альтернативным вариантом извлечения подключенных устройств есть использование окна безопасного извлечения устройств:

Ещё одним простым вариантом безопасного извлечения устройства есть возможность выбрать пункт Извлечь в контекстном меню, которое можно открыть нажав правой кнопкой мыши на флешке в проводнике.

Чтобы не было ситуаций когда пользователю приходится искать решение проблемы: вытащила флешку без безопасного извлечения, можно в свойствах флешки нужно изменить политику удаления.

  • Быстрое удаление — данный параметр отключает кэширование записей на устройстве и в Windows. В текущей ситуации при отключении устройства использовать значок Безопасное удаление оборудования в области уведомлений не обязательно.
  • Оптимальная производительность — данный параметр разрешает кэширование записей в Windows. При отключении устройства настоятельно рекомендуется использовать значок Безопасное извлечение устройства в области уведомлений.

По умолчанию в операционной системе Windows 10 на большинстве устройств установлен пункт быстрое удаление. Благодаря текущей политики удаления пользователи могут без проблем извлекать флешки с компьютера, которые не используются системой.

Всё да ничего бы, но бывают ситуации, когда значок безопасного извлечения устройства Windows 10 просто не отображается. Самым простым решением проблемы есть использование второго варианта правильного извлечения устройств. Выполнить текущую команду можно даже тогда, когда значок безопасного извлечения устройства отсутствует.


После чего средство устранения неполадок USB в Windows после завершения диагностики внесет изменения в систему. После чего можно попробовать и повторно попытаться выполнить предыдущую операцию.

Выводы

Безопасное извлечение устройства в Windows 10 является необходимой функцией для любого пользователя. Как безопасно извлечь флешку из компьютера под управлением Windows 10 выбирать пользователю, поскольку способом извлечения несколько. Есть даже возможность выполнять извлечение флешки без функции безопасного извлечения устройства.

А также в пользователей есть возможность загрузить утилиты сторонних производителей, которые имеют простой интерфейс и позволяют аналогично проводить безопасное извлечение устройств.

На самом деле я и так всегда извлекаю флешку или внешний диск, через безопасное извлечение устройств, но стандартная программа меня бесит, своей тормознутостью… И эта программа ещё предотвратит попадание autorun …

Зачем нужно безопасное извлечение устройств?

На самом деле тема довольно популярная, как среди новичков, так среди профессионалов… Споров много, но я сейчас вам расскажу теорию и практику.

1. То что люди говорят что флешка может сгореть , это не совсем реально, т.к. напряжение подается маленькое, но все же я спалил флешку, когда вытащил её при загрузке компьютера, но я предполагаю на брак, она у меня не так долго продержалась… Но все же теперь всегда извлекаю безопасно, либо жду пока компьютер выключится. Как быть вам, уже решать не мне, мое дело посоветовать… Но спешка ни к чему хорошему не приводит, и вот с эти согласится большинство.

2. Теперь более о реальном. Данные могут потеряться . Вот это факт, так как перед записью данные передаются в кэш и потом уже на флешку. Одно дело не скопируется что-то, а то и вообще по случайности что-то может повредится.

Вот две основные причины, по которым стоит извлекать внешние носители.

Все не любят безопасно извлекать устройства лишь потому, что это долго. Я согласен, меня бесит стандартная программа и по этому избавимся от этих мучений 🙂

Программа предоставляется бесплатно, лишь некоторые функции её платны, но они нам не понадобятся…

Скачиваем бесплатно программу для безопасного извлечения устройств тут:

Интерфейс программы Antirun прост до безумия. Программа для безопасного извлечения устройств находится так же в панели рядом с часами.

Когда в компьютере появится новое устройство, программа предложит выполнить действие.

Делается для того чтобы в компьютер не попал вирус, так же для удобства, можно сразу посмотреть сколько свободного места на флешке или на сколько она занята .

В списке вы можете открыть диск, защитить его от вирусов (это платная услуга), ну и не обязательна она если вы уже подобрали себе .

Ну или вы передумали открывать устройство или ошиблись, можно сразу безопасно извлечь устройство .

Настройки программы для безопасного извлечения устройств

Нажимаем правой кнопкой мыши по программе и выбираем настройки.

Теперь настроим программа для ещё большего комфорта.

Настроек хоть и не много в программе для безопасного извлечения устройств, но все же есть некоторые, которые добавят вам удобства.

В настройках имеется:

Автозапуск — если понравилась программа ставьте галочку, она будет запускаться при загрузке.

Не показывать диалог, если autorun не обнаружен — если нет файла autorun.ini на флешке, то можно не показывать диалог. Ставим если хочется лазить постоянно в мой компьютер.

Закрывать диалог после выбора действия — галочку ставим, для того чтобы после вашего нажатия на программу диалог выбора исчезал.

Отключать запуск всех устройств — если вам не нужен или у вас постоянно вирусы на носителях, ставим галочку.

Уведомлять о beta-версиях — программа будет уведомлять вас об обновлениях программы, которые ещё могут иметь ошибки.

И язык интерфейса — думаю понятно)

Безопасное извлечение устройств

Нажимаем левой кнопкой по значку и выбираем устройство, которое надо извлечь. Все, вы успешно освоили программу для безопасного извлечения устройств 🙂

Почему нет значка извлечь флешку? windows 7 нет значка безопасное извлечение устройств: usb, мобильного телефона

В один прекрасный момент (скорее всего после манипуляций и установки Касперского) неожиданно пропала “зеленая стрелка” в трее – безопасное извлечение устройств . До этого, вставляя usb флешку в компьютер, значок появлялся, то теперь нет и usb safely remove не происходит. Хотя в списке доступных дисков (сменных устройств) присутствует. И все манипуляции с файлами на флешке производятся.

1. Исправить такой ключ в реестре


“Services”=dword:0000001b
“HotPlugFlags”=dword:00000002

2. Еще вариант можно попробовать так (для Vista, для XP - похоже)

Пуск -> Настройка -> Панель задач и меню "Пуск" -> или

Правой кнопкой мышки на панели задач -> Свойства -> Вкладка "Область уведомлений" -> Значки | Настроить

Находим "Безопасное извлечение устройств" и в "Поведении" выбираем "Всегда отображать".

3. А чтобы не мучатся с настройками нужно

через команду "Выполнить " вызвать окно безопасного отключения USB-устройств выполнив команду :

rundll32 shell32.dll,Control_RunDLL hotplug.dll

и закрыть нужное вам устройство. Неудобно. Да. Но зато работает.

к меню

Как убрать иконку в систрее?

Пропал и не появляется, не отображается значок usb флешки (иконка в трее) безопасное извлечение устройств

Часто пользователи жалуются на то, что стандартная иконка Безопасное Извлечение Устройства не отображается в трее , хотя к компьютеру подключены hotplug устройства. Но удивительная программа USB Safely Remove полностью лишена данной проблемы. Она полностью заменяет родную иконку "Безопасное извлечение устройств" (Safely Remove Hardware) и взамен отображает свою.

По умолчанию, иконка USB Safely Remove всегда присутствует в трее, что дает быстрый доступ к функциональности программы и делает работу с USB более понятной и предсказуемой.

Однако, вы можете изменить это поведение и иконка будет исчезать тогда, когда нет ни одного подключенного устройства. Для этого включите флажок "Hide icon when there are no devices to be stopped" в секции настроек "Look And Feel".

к меню

Что это за программа такая, USB Safely Remove?

Это менеджер USB устройств , он экономит время и расширяет возможности пользователя при активной работе с флэшками, переносными винчестерами, кард-ридерами и другими гаджетами.

Программа выполняет...

  • удобное безопасное извлечение устройств , избавленное от недостатков встроенного в Windows;
  • показывает какие программы мешают извлечь устройство;
  • убирает диски пустых слотов кард-ридеров;
  • умеет возвращать обратно отключенные устройства;
  • и содержит массу других функций для комфортной и приятной работы с hot-plug устройствами (USB, SATA, FireWire) .

Устройство не может быть остановлено прямо сейчас. Почему?

Часто возникает такая ситуация, что Windows не позволяет извлечь устройство? USB Safely Remove , в отличие от Windows в таком случае показывает программы, которые мешают отключить устройство, и позволяет либо закрыть сами эти программы, либо закрыть файлы, которые они открыли на устройстве.

Скачать эту удивительную программу можно по адресу:

http://safelyremove.com/ru/

Примечание : Помните, что применяя скаченные бесплатно из сети программы, Вы принимаете на себя все риски.


к меню

Как настроить безопасное извлечение флешки в Total Commander 7.50 Final

Если пропала стандартная иконка значек в трее "Безопасное извлечение устройства" (флешки USB) , то в Тотал Коммандере в версии 7.5 есть чудесная команда "Извлечь". Я ею и пользуюсь в Виндоуз 7.0.

Работает она так. Когда вы желаете извлечь флешку кард-ридер без потери данных , то вы выбираете свое устройство с флешкой. Правой клавишей нажимаете на ваше устройство в списке дисководов Total Commander 7.50. Там выбираете команду "Извлечь". Нажимаете. Устройство закрывается. В Windows 7 выдается сообщение: "Устройство USB можно безопасно извлечь ". Поэтому его можно безопасно извлекать.

Примечание : В других версиях Windows такое сообщение может не выдаваться.



Загрузка...